    Mō mātou | Pathways

    As a leading mental health and addiction service provider in Aotearoa, we are proud to support people to live full lives within their communities; hopeful and connected to what matters to them.

    • Te Whiwhingamahi | The Opportunity

      A unique role to inspire and lead a nine‑bed Residential Recovery Service. Use established systems and processes to meet compliance requirements and optimise the service to meet local need. Develop and grow your team to work top of their scope as community support workers.

      Be part of great partnerships that deliver; including working alongside Primary care providers, Te Whatu Ora and Te Aka Whai Ora colleagues to support tangata whai ora and their whānau.

      This is a full‑time position working Monday to Friday, 8.30 am to 5.00 pm. Additionally, you will be supported to be part of a rotating after‑hours on‑call roster.
